A Proposal Request, often shortened to RFQ, is a formal communication sent by a organization to prospective providers seeking prices on defined requirements. The RFQ provides detailed specifications about the required products, allowing suppliers to submit accurate proposals.
Following review of the submitted quotes, the buyer can then choose here a contract to the most acceptable supplier, commencing the procurement process.

Seeking Competitive Quotes
When embarking on a new project or making significant purchases, it's crucial to contrast prices from diverse vendors. Requesting competitive quotes allows you to gauge the market value of goods or services and secure the most beneficial terms. By performing thorough research and requesting quotes from a broad range of providers, you can optimize your chances of securing the best deal possible.
- Remember that competitive quotes should include all pertinent details, such as pricing, payment terms, delivery schedules, and guarantees.
- Refrain from be afraid to negotiate with vendors to attain the most favorable price.
- Clarity is essential throughout the quoting process.
